Output 59d8c668ecd6fa443e269aac527dfbe1a5617f0e2d7608e8f8e9e8cd8040b339:1

value
1471863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6feefca78afe8f5eaf2313e4c3fbdfdc50501e1d OP_EQUAL
address
3BtsDwUYPZ4xAYr2T9WSwQj8y42QRpWsY3
transaction
59d8c668ecd6fa443e269aac527dfbe1a5617f0e2d7608e8f8e9e8cd8040b339
spent
true